Job summary

HCA Florida Capital Primary Care is seeking a Medical Assistant for a full-time, daytime schedule (Monday–Friday) in Tallahassee, FL. You will support clinicians by taking patient histories, measuring vital signs, preparing exam rooms, and assisting with injections, labs, and minor procedures.

The role requires at least one year of medical assisting experience and certified MA credentials (RMA/CCMA/CMA/NCMA/NRCMA or ABR-OE).

Qualifications

  • One year of Medical Assisting or other direct clinical patient care experience in a healthcare setting.
  • Must have Medical Assistant Certification (RMA, CCMA, CMA, NCMA, NRCMA or ABR-OE) credentials.
  • Recent graduates must obtain Medical Assistant certification within 60 days of employment or within one year if already employed.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are patients for examination by taking histories and vital signs.
  • Prepare exam rooms with necessary instruments and maintain supplies/equipment, including sterilization.
  • Administer injections and assist with lab testing and phlebotomy.
  • Assist physicians in preparing for minor surgeries and physicals.

What Qualifications you will need:
EXPERIENCE:

One year of Medical Assisting or other direct clinical patient care experience in a healthcare setting.

CERTIFICATION/LICENSE: 3 ways to qualify

Medical Assistant Certification is required. Acceptable certifications are RMA, CCMA, CMA, NCMA, NRCMA certification, or ABR-OE credentials is acceptable OR

Medical Assistants who recently graduated (within the last 12 months) from a Medical Assisting training program must obtain Medical Assistant certification within 60 days of employment. OR

Candidates/incumbents with one year of Medical Assistant work experience who do not possess Medical Assistant Certification must obtain Medical Assistant Certification within one year of hire date.
